关于给JTree的每一个子节点,添加监听的问题

问题描述

关于给JTree的每一个子节点,添加监听的问题

我想给JTree的每子节点添加不同的监听,点击一个子节点,就弹出一个窗口,
!!注意 :是每个子节点 都弹出一个不同的窗口。

TreePath path = Tree.getSelectionPath();
TreeNode node = (TreeNode) path.getLastPathComponent();

这个方法能实现吗?求大神指点一下。

解决方案

怎么给 JAVA ---JTREE 每个子节点添加个个事件?

时间: 2024-09-26 07:41:31

关于给JTree的每一个子节点,添加监听的问题的相关文章

Zookeeper命令行操作(常用命令;客户端连接;查看znode路径;创建节点;获取znode数据,查看节点内容,设置节点内容,删除节点;监听znode事件;telnet连接zookeeper)

8.1.常用命令 启动ZK服务 bin/zkServer.sh start 查看ZK服务状态 bin/zkServer.sh status 停止ZK服务 bin/zkServer.sh stop 重启ZK服务 bin/zkServer.sh restart 连接服务器 zkCli.sh -server 127.0.0.1:2181   8.2 客户端连接 运行 zkCli.sh –server <ip>进入命令行工具 在192.168.106.82服务器上连接到192.168.106.81服务

java-Java关于树的子节点添加事件问题

问题描述 Java关于树的子节点添加事件问题 请问我想在Java树里面为每一个子节点添加事件,并且当我单击不同的子节点时会在JTextArea显示不同的信息,这个信息是我自己写的,我是新手,希望您能给我写个例子,谢谢 解决方案 java实现树的添加和取父节点,子节点;聚合树,实现选项菜单功能WINFORM Treeview 子节点添加问题extjs树节点销毁事件问题 解决方案二: 参考:http://zhidao.baidu.com/link?url=BJ0OKONQ11AKvna2FgSI2c

jquery-如何用JQuery取当前元素第n个子节点?

问题描述 如何用JQuery取当前元素第n个子节点? 我现在已经得到了tr元素节点tr下有5个td我现在想出第2个和第3个td节点 解决方案 $(""tr:eq(2)"")$(""tr:eq(3)"") 解决方案二: jquery 取子节点及当前节点属性值 解决方案三: var tds=$('td:eq(1)td:eq(2)'tr) 解决方案四: $(""td"").index() 解决

如何给easyui的某个子节点挂载单击事件?(附demo)

问题描述 如何给easyui的某个子节点挂载单击事件?(附demo) 这个demo只能给全部的节点加单击事件 如何只给node111加单击事件? <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<link rel="stylesheet" type="text/css" href="../../themes/default/e

TreeView如何实现联动,选择一个子节点,其父节点虚选择

问题描述 类型:VB.NETWINFORMTreeView如何实现联动,选择一个子节点,其父节点虚选择如上:这是效果,PS的谁能提供个实例 解决方案 解决方案二:.net中的TreeView控件,是實現不了這個功能的,因為牠的選擇框,衹有兩個狀態Checked和UnChecked可以從TreeView派生一個新類來實現,請參考這篇文章解决方案三:应该可以用StateImageList选中状态StateImageList的图片列表变换来实现以上效果设置StateImageList怎么弄有没有这方面

js-如何用JQury选择tr td的第六个子节点?

问题描述 如何用JQury选择tr td的第六个子节点? 这个只能选第一个节点我把first换成sixth也不好使 <script type=""text/javascript""> $(document).ready(function(){ $(""tr td:first-child"").each(function(){ alert($(this).text()); if($(this).text()==und

xml-C# XML向根节点添加Element语句未执行

问题描述 C# XML向根节点添加Element语句未执行 string path = Environment.CurrentDirectory + "\XMLNote.xml"; if (!File.Exists(path)) { XDocument document = new XDocument(); XDeclaration xdec = new XDeclaration("1.0", "gb2312", "yes")

javascript-js 为节点添加checked属性 怎么审查元素和源代码都看不到

问题描述 js 为节点添加checked属性 怎么审查元素和源代码都看不到 js 为 radio 节点添加checked属性 怎么"审查元素"和"查看源代码"都看不到? 解决方案 你这样赋值算property,不是attribute,你要反应到dom中用setAttribute方法 document.getElementById('cb').setAttribute('checked',false) 可以看下这个:jquery attr prop 区别 解决方案二:

SpriteBuilder中不能编辑自定义类或不能给节点添加属性的解决

不能编辑自定义类 你选中一个Sub File(CCBFile)节点,在这个例子中,该节点的Custom class区域灰化禁用且不能修改.这是因为你需要在该Sub File引用的CCB文件中修改Custom class. 不能给节点添加通用属性 为了使一个节点拥有自定义属性,必须给其赋予一个自定义类(这个不一定,也可以用其通用父类作为自定义类).该自定义类需要的属性或实例变量与通用属性的名字相匹配.